Weekly Task Scheduling & Expense Tracker Excel Template
This comprehensive Excel template is specifically designed to integrate the functionality of Task Scheduling with an efficient Expense Tracker, optimized for a Weekly usage cycle. The template combines time management and financial tracking into one cohesive system, making it ideal for project managers, small business owners, freelancers, or individuals managing personal responsibilities alongside spending habits.
The design leverages standard Excel features—tables, formulas, conditional formatting, and dynamic charts—to provide a flexible yet user-friendly experience. It enables users to track daily task assignments with deadlines and progress while simultaneously monitoring weekly expenses by category. This dual-purpose structure ensures that both productivity and financial accountability are maintained in a single document.
Sheet Names
The template includes the following sheets, each serving a distinct but complementary function:
- Task Scheduler (Weekly): Tracks all scheduled tasks with due dates, priority levels, and progress status.
- Expense Tracker (Weekly): Records all weekly expenses with category classification, amounts, and payment methods.
- Summary Dashboard: Aggregates key metrics from both sheets including total task completion rate, total weekly spend, average daily expenditure, and top expense categories.
- Settings & Instructions: Contains user guidelines, formula references, and setup instructions to ensure proper use.
Table Structures & Data Organization
All tables are structured as Excel Tables (using the "Insert > Table" feature) for dynamic filtering and automatic expansion. This allows users to add rows without breaking formulas or formatting.
Task Scheduler (Weekly) Sheet
This sheet contains a table with the following columns:
- Date: Date of task assignment (formatted as 'DD/MM/YYYY'). Data type: Date.
- Task Title: Brief description of the task. Data type: Text (up to 100 characters).
- Assigned To: Name or ID of the person responsible. Data type: Text.
- Due Date: Deadline for completion. Data type: Date.
- Priority: High, Medium, or Low. Data type: Dropdown (using a defined list).
- Status: To Do, In Progress, Completed. Data type: Dropdown.
- Progress (%): Numeric value from 0 to 100 indicating completion status.
- Notes: Optional field for additional details or context. Data type: Text (up to 255 characters).
Expense Tracker (Weekly) Sheet
This sheet organizes expenses with the following columns:
- Date: Date of expense occurrence. Data type: Date.
- Category: Type of expenditure (e.g., Groceries, Transport, Office Supplies). Data type: Dropdown list with predefined options.
- Description: Detailed explanation of the transaction. Data type: Text.
- Amount (USD): Expense value in US dollars. Data type: Currency (automatically formatted).
- Payment Method: Credit Card, Cash, Bank Transfer, etc. Data type: Dropdown.
- Receipt Attached?: Yes/No (toggle for file linking). Data type: Boolean (Yes/No).
Formulas Required
The template uses several built-in Excel formulas to ensure accuracy and automation:
- Task Completion Rate Calculation: =COUNTIFS(Status, "Completed") / COUNTA(Date) in the Task Scheduler sheet.
- Total Weekly Expenses: =SUM(Expense Tracker!Amount) to calculate total weekly spending.
- Average Daily Expense: =SUM(Weekly Expenses)/7 (for a full week).
- Top Expense Category: Using SUMIFS and INDEX-MATCH functions to identify the largest category by spending.
- Due Date Alerts: In the Task Scheduler, use conditional formatting with IF(Due Date < TODAY(), "Overdue", "") to flag overdue tasks.
- Progress Bars: Uses formulas like =IF(Progress>0, Progress/100, 0) for visual progress indicators.
Conditional Formatting Rules
The template includes intelligent conditional formatting to improve visibility and decision-making:
- Overdue Tasks: Cells with Due Date less than Today are highlighted in red (background).
- High-Priority Tasks: Rows where Priority = "High" are highlighted in yellow.
- Late Progress Updates: If Progress < 30%, the row turns orange.
- Spending Threshold Alerts: In the Expense Tracker, any amount greater than $100 is marked in red to highlight large expenses.
- Status Indicators: Background colors change based on Status (Green for Completed, Yellow for In Progress, Gray for To Do).
Instructions for the User
To use this template effectively:
- Open the Excel file and ensure all sheets are visible.
- In the "Task Scheduler" sheet, input tasks with clear titles, due dates, and assign responsibilities. Use dropdowns to select priority and status.
- In the "Expense Tracker" sheet, record all expenses by entering date, category, amount, description, and payment method.
- Update task progress each day using the % column or change status in the dropdown field.
- Review the "Summary Dashboard" weekly to assess performance metrics such as completion rate and total spend.
- To add new entries, simply append rows below existing data—tables will auto-expand without manual intervention.
- Save a copy of the file with a clear name (e.g., "Weekly_Task_Expense_Tracker_Jan2024.xlsx") to maintain version control.
